18,090,261 is an odd compos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
18090261 is an odd compos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 18090261:
32 × 72 × 17 × 19 × 127
(3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 19 × 127)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 18090261 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 18090261
Divisors of 18090261
- Number of divisors d(n): 72
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 3 7 9 17 19 21 49 51 57 63 119 127 133 147 153 171 323 357 381 399 441 833 889 931 969 1071 1143 1197 2159 2261 2413 2499 2667 2793 2907 6223 6477 6783 7239 7497 8001 8379 15113 15827 16891 18669 19431 20349 21717 41021 45339 47481 50673 56007 105791 118237 123063 136017 142443 152019 287147 317373 354711 369189 861441 952119 1064133 2010029 2584323 6030087 18090261
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 34145280
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 16055019
- 18090261 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(16055019)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 2035242
